How traditional vibrators work (and why they plateau)

Most clitoral vibrators rely on oscillation. A motor rapidly moves back and forth, creating vibration that travels through the toy into the tissue. It's reliable, it works for most people, and it's been the industry standard for decades.

But there's a catch. After a few minutes of direct vibration, the sensation flattens. Your nerve endings adapt to consistent stimulation. This is called habituation, and it's why some people find themselves turning up the intensity dial, chasing a peak that keeps moving.

It's also why many people report feeling "numb" after using a traditional vibrator for more than 10 or 15 minutes, even if they haven't reached orgasm yet.

How suction technology changes the game

Lemon vibrators work on a different principle entirely. Instead of buzzing against the clitoris, they create a gentle seal and use rhythmic suction to stimulate the entire nerve cluster beneath the surface.

Think of it like this: a traditional vibrator is a jackhammer. A lemon sexual toy is a wave.

The suction creates a pulsing sensation that stimulates a broader area of the clitoral network. Your clitoris isn't just the small visible nub. It's an internal structure about the size of a pea on the surface, but it extends several inches internally. Suction reaches those deeper nerve endings in a way that surface vibration simply cannot.

This is why orgasms from lemon adult toys often feel different. They tend to build more gradually, feel more full-body, and last longer. Many people report that suction stimulation doesn't fatigue the tissue the way intense vibration does.

The nerve science behind why it feels so different

Your clitoris has roughly 8,000 nerve endings concentrated in the glans (the visible part). Traditional vibration fires these nerves rapidly and repeatedly. The sensation is sharp, focused, and easy to feel immediately.

Suction stimulates differently. It engages mechanoreceptors throughout the vulva and deeper clitoral network simultaneously. This means the stimulation isn't just localized to the surface. It's more dimensional.

Another factor: suction creates what's sometimes called a "gentle pulling" sensation rather than a buzzing one. This pulls slightly at the tissue, which can feel more intimate and less like you're sitting on a machine. For people sensitive to high-frequency vibration, this is genuinely life-changing.

Customizing the experience: intensity and rhythm

One major advantage of lemon sexual toys is pattern variability. Most high-quality suction vibrators like the lem include multiple pulse patterns. Pattern 1 might be a slow, steady rhythm. Pattern 5 might be a rapid fluttering. Pattern 8 might be a long pull followed by shorter pulses.

This matters because it means you're not just turning up intensity. You're changing the actual sensation architecture. Start with a slower pattern to warm up, then shift to something more dynamic once you're aroused. This rhythm flexibility actually reduces the habituation problem that plagues traditional vibrators.

With a lemon clitoral vibrator, your body stays engaged because the sensation is actually changing, not just getting stronger.

The material difference matters too

Most high-quality lemon adult toys are made from medical-grade silicone. This is important for two reasons. First, silicone is genuinely softer and more skin-friendly than harder plastics. When you're using a toy through suction, that contact matters. Harder materials can feel more clinical.

Second, silicone is non-porous, which means it's easier to clean and less likely to harbor bacteria. If you're using a suction toy regularly, this is a practical advantage.

Are lemon clitoral vibrators harder to clean than traditional vibrators?

No, actually the opposite. Medical-grade silicone is non-porous, making it simpler to clean than some harder plastics. Rinse with warm water and mild soap, or use a toy cleaner. The suction cup area should be dried thoroughly. Most lemon vibrators come with care instructions specific to their design.

Can you use lube with a lemon vibrator?

Yes, and many people do. Water-based lubricant is compatible with silicone toys. Some people find that a little lube helps the seal feel more comfortable, especially if they're new to suction stimulation. Apply a small amount to your body rather than the toy itself to maintain a good suction seal.
